About Me 
 
I am a lively fun loving person and because of my short attention span I can be quite exhausting and demanding at times. 
I love loud music and listening to my ipod. Although I like to watch DVDs, I also enjoy being outdoors and or to go swimming. My family are very important to me and I love to see them regularly. I am able to feed and dress myself, although you may need to help me put my t-shirt on the right way round. I require assistance with my personal care and need to be reminded to wash hands, brush teeth or put clothes in the laundry basket instead of on the floor. Although I am willing to assist with household chores, you will need to help me to do them correctly and be responsible for keeping my house clean & tidy.
 
I have a good sense of humour, although I often laugh at others misfortune. I have very limited speech but my understanding is reasonable. I do get very frustrated if I cannot understand things or things are not explained clearly. I have obsessional behaviours around my favourite toys and activities but I am hoping that you can help me broaden my interests.
